Output 21f9baa86b0ea104d5cfe3ae70884fad8ccfbcc5d250226388d090e3619dad75:1

value
48224650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d51f8164679c9241b5c34863587079b265f9965 OP_EQUALVERIFY OP_CHECKSIG
address
1MBEXhzTJhcPnepXeykDHgitPRCzzBFRSr
transaction
21f9baa86b0ea104d5cfe3ae70884fad8ccfbcc5d250226388d090e3619dad75
spent
true